Some slightly longer servo arms were needed for the aileron pushrods to achieve proper clearance and adequate throw.

Again, 30 minute epoxy was used during installation of the rudder and elevator. All the control surfaces used CA hinges, which were easily installed with t-pins and thin CA glue.
